Course Overview

This course describes the polymerization reaction kinetics and types in detail. It covers all polymerization mechanisms and is continuously updated to technological advances. It covers different approaches, catalysts, conditions, reactors, control schemes so that the attendant is presented with all aspects of Ethylene Polymerization Reactors technology. Solvent types are explained in detail and case studies are presented. Radical, cationic, anionic and catalytic approaches are investigated and explained via theory and applications.

Course Outline

Day 1: Reaction Kinetics, Thermodynamics, and Catalytic Principles

  • Fundamentals of reaction kinetics: reaction rates and rate constants (k values)
  • Energy diagrams and activation energies in ethylene polymerization
  • Types of reactions involved in polymerization processes
  • Introduction to reaction thermodynamics: Equilibrium and phase equilibrium concepts
  • Application of Le Chatelier's principle and understanding of equilibrium shifts
  • Introduction to catalytic reactions in polymerization
  • Catalyst fundamentals: types, poisoning, deactivation, and structural properties
  • Chemical and physical characteristics of polymerization catalysts

Day 2: Polymerization Reaction Mechanisms and Reactor Systems

  • Overview of polymerization reactions: Addition and condensation mechanisms
  • Step-growth versus chain-growth polymerization pathways
  • Comparison between homogeneous and heterogeneous polymerization systems
  • Anionic and cationic polymerization processes
  • Free radical polymerization mechanisms
  • Coordination polymerization and its role in polyethylene production
  • Reactor vessels used in various polymerization processes and their applications

Day 3: Polyethylene Production and Polymerization Methods

  • Polyethylene properties and their significance in applications
  • Financial considerations in polyethylene production and market value
  • Grades and types of polyethylene materials
  • Homopolymerization techniques: free radical and catalytic approaches
  • Homopolymerization of polar vinyl monomers
  • Copolymerization with polar vinyl monomers for enhanced material properties

Day 4: Solvent Effects and Advanced Radical Polymerization Techniques

  • Free radical polymerization processes in organic solvents
  • Selection and impact of different organic solvents on polymerization
  • Understanding phase equilibrium and solvent effects in reaction systems
  • Influence of Lewis acids on polymerization efficiency
  • Controlled radical polymerization strategies
  • Free radical polymerization in aqueous systems
  • Radical polymerization in emulsions with cationic and anionic stabilization
  • Polymerization processes in hybrid solvent environments

Day 5: Copolymerization Strategies and Hybrid Polymerization Mechanisms

  • Free radical copolymerization with polar vinyl monomers
  • Key factors influencing copolymerization processes
  • Ethylene copolymerization with MMA, Styrene, and Vinyl Acetate
  • Copolymerization in emulsion systems for material diversification
  • Hybrid free radical and catalytic polymerization mechanisms
  • The synergy between hybrid mechanisms for advanced polymer production
  • Detailed mechanisms of Ethylene–MMA and Styrene–Ethylene hybrid copolymerization
  • Hybrid copolymerization via ATRP (Atom Transfer Radical Polymerization) systems
